What is the role of the multi-stage circulating Mcq intercooler?
In a two- or multi-stage air compressor, the intercooler is always placed between the low pressure (LP) and high pressure (HP) cylinders.The purpose of the intercooler is to The work input to the compressor is reduced to achieve the same pressure as a single compressor can.

What happens when water cooling is used in multistage compression?
Water cooling is usually used in air compressors. Intercooler not only reduces work input, but also lowers compressor discharge temperature for better lubrication and longer compressor life.

What is the function of the aftercooler?
An aftercooler is a mechanical heat exchanger designed to Remove the heat of compression from the compressed air stream and prepare the air so that it can then enter the dryer and/oror for pneumatic equipment.

Why do gas turbines use intercoolers?
Adding an intercooler to the gas turbine cycle reduce compressionthis is achieved by dividing the compression process into two or more stages, the outlet air/gas of each stage is cooled to the minimum cycle temperature by an intercooler/heat exchanger.
What’s in the intercooler?
Intercooler is a heat exchanger Installed between the engine’s super or turbocharger and the intake manifold. Its job is to absorb and dissipate heat from the charge air in order to provide the coldest and densest air to the engine. There are two types of intercoolers, air-to-air and water-to-air.

What is the main purpose of using an intercooler with a compressor?
The function of the intercooler
The main function of the air compressor intercooler is to Cool the air before it enters the next compression stage. The higher density of cold air makes it easier to compress than hot air. Ideally, the air should be as close to the ambient air temperature as possible.
